Österreich - The concern for telephone fraud has increased in the past few weeks, in particular due to the repeated fraud calls with the Austrian area code +43. According to Vol.at often pronounced as employees of PayPal and try to obtain personal data from the callers. These calls appear harmless at first glance, but often contain threatening claims about alleged irregularities on the PayPal accounts of the called
The fraudsters use aggressive discussion to put people under pressure and get them to reveal sensitive information. The numbers used by the fraudsters include the numbers +43 372 36636228 and +43 664 8570613. The aim of the callers is to either get access to PayPal accounts or to use the stolen data for identity theft.
warning signals and protective measures
experts advise you to put on such calls immediately and not to call it back. Another warning signal is automatic announcements during the call. A simple "yes" could even be misused to conclude unwanted contracts. Users should block the number for repeated calls or report them to platforms such as Tellows to warn others of these fraudsters.
In a specific case, a user reported PayPal Community that he had received a call from a number that spent a PayPal. After completing the call immediately, he found that there was no risk for his PayPal account because he had not confirmed or passed on personal data. Nevertheless, it is advisable to report telephone numbers of such fraudsters to the Federal Network Agency and to update its safety data regularly.

The police pursue payment paths to identify the fraudsters, but there are no details of their investigations. In many cases, these are perpetrators who operate abroad while international cooperation within the EU works well. In order to effectively counteract the fraud attempts, it is important that the population works together, provides information and participates in prevention measures. Important prevention measures include, among other things, not to pass on personal data or money to unknown persons if there is suspicion and to check the authenticity of the caller, but not to recall the number displayed. In the event of serious suspicions, the police should be informed immediately.
